Default Power window works fine until the last 1/2 inch at the top

So my power window needs help in the last half inch to stay up. It goes up and down fine but at the top it just clicks and jumps but won't go all the way up on it's own. Is this something that can be fixed or should I just get a new regulator since they're like $30 on ebay?

And if I get one, can I swap my old motor? Or should I get one with a motor? I remember trying to swap a motor on my jetta regulator and it just falls apart and is nearly impossible.

From what I can tell this sounds exactly like a regulator, I would remove the door panel and look inside the panel for the regulator as you go up/down with the window before I blew the $30, but if you don't care buy it and hope thats it. Always a safer bet to not end up with extra parts though.

is the regulator being held by all 4 bolts? I had a similar issue and it was because 3 bolts were missing and the regulator had a lot of play to move.

You can separate the regulator from the motor I think it is a couple of screws, chances are it is the regulator. If you can get a regulator and motor together cheap then go that route.

i would also check the window channel seal (might have folded). the seal that the window sets in as it goes up and down. like others say, check the mounting of the regulator/motor. it sounds like it's binding when it gets to the top and stops.

Sounds like what mine did when the teeth on the regulator wore down and stripped out. You can purchase just the regulator or both regulator and motor for fairly cheap if you need that as well.
